Description: 
At 601 PM EDT, trained weather spotters reported Flash Flooding occuring near the intersection of Hungary Road and Springfield Road. Between 2 and 3 inches of rain have fallen. Additional rainfall amounts up to 0.5 inches are possible in the warned area. Flash flooding is ongoing. HAZARD...Flash flooding caused by thunderstorms. SOURCE...Trained spotters reported. IMPACT...Flash flooding of small creeks and streams, urban areas, highways, streets and underpasses as well as other poor drainage and low-lying areas. Some locations that will experience flash flooding include... Richmond, Ashland, Tuckahoe, Virginia Union University, University Of Richmond, Randolph Macon College, Virginia Commonwealth University, Downtown Richmond, Bon Air, Mechanicsville, Highland Springs, Hanover, Laurel, Glen Allen, Lakeside, Wyndham, East Highland Park, Manakin, Sabot and Greendale.
Instruction: 
Turn around, don't drown when encountering flooded roads. Most flood deaths occur in vehicles. Be aware of your surroundings and do not drive on flooded roads. Please report flooding by calling 757-899-2415, posting to the NWS Wakefield Facebook page, or using X @NWSWAKEFIELDVA.
